Supersymmetric AdS6 via T duality
Y Lozano1, E Ó Colgáin1, D Rodríguez-Gómez1
1Departamento de Física, Universidad de Oviedo, Oviedo 33007, Spain.
Abstract:
We present a new supersymmetric AdS(6) solution of type IIB supergravity with SU(2) isometry. Through the AdS/CFT correspondence, this has potentially very interesting implications for 5D fixed point theories. This solution is the result of a non-Abelian T duality on the known supersymmetric AdS(6) solution of massive IIA. The SU(2) R symmetry is untouched, leading to sixteen supercharges and preserved supersymmetry.
